Bittersweet chocolate ice cream


 Bittersweet chocolate ice cream recipe in the ice cream category

 Recipe ingredients:

  • 2 (3 1/2 ounce) bars Tobler bittersweet chocolate, finely chopped
  • 2 cups half-and-half
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 3 large egg yolks at room temperature
  • Pinch of salt
  • 2/3 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ract


 Recipe method:

  • Combine chopped chocolate, half-and-half and milk in a medium size saucepan.
  • Cook, stirring, over low heat until chocolate melts and mixture is smooth, being careful not to scorch. Set aside.
  • Beat egg yolks with the salt and sugar until sugar is dissolved. Add 1/2 cup of the chocolate mixture to the yolks to warm them, mix thoroughly. Add yolk mixture to the balance of the chocolate mixture.
  • Return to heat and cook slowly, stirring constantly, until thick enough to coat a spoon, about 2 minutes. Stir in vanilla extract off the heat and allow to cool.
  • Pour mixture into an ice cream maker and freeze according to manufacturer directions.
